April 18, 2002

SEC Women’s Tennis Championship
Hosted by University of South Carolina (Columbia, SC)

# 5 Tennesee Co-Coach Mike Patrick
“We’re finally getting players back from injury. It was a hot day, but overall I think we played ok. We have to keep working toward playing to our full potential. We aren’t there yet.”

(On tomorrow’s match against USC)
“They handled us easily a couple of weeks ago. We’re looking forward to playing them again. We must play to our full potential in order to give them a good match.”

Tennessee player Vilmarie Castellvi
“I was ready to play today and maybe my opponent wasn’t quite as ready.

(On the rain delay)
“When we came back outside, I knew that I would have to give it 100% to win because of the distraction.

(On tomorrow’s match against USC)
“Tomorrow will be a good match. We will give them a better battle than the last time we met them a couple of weeks ago.”

#12 Arkansas Coach Kevin Platt
“I’m proud of the way we competed. It wasn’t easy, being down a person and only able to compete with five players. It is draining for our players both emotionally and physically. We extended a match against a team that beat us more handily during the regular season. Tennessee was just the better team today. We have a couple of kids that are hurt and we are going to come back next year stronger. ”

Arkansas player Anna Dybicz
“I think we competed tough but unfortunately we were not at full strength. I don’t want to speculate on what would have happened if we were at full strength. I don’t want to take anything away from Tennessee, they played a great match.”
